Abstract
The present invention discloses a kind of intelligent home control system, including the sensor group, the remote control commands for receiving control host and the equipment control group and mobile terminal that execute action for controlling host, being installed on indoor different zones for monitoring of environmental information;Wherein sensor group, equipment control group and mobile terminal are connect with control host;Controlling host includes:Information acquisition module, data processing module and communication module.The present invention discloses a kind of intelligent domestic system, by the mating reaction for controlling host, sensor group, equipment control group and mobile terminal, can when the condition of a disaster occurs timely processing the condition of a disaster, avoid occurring the case where leading to resident's person property damage because delaying the best make-up time.

Embodiment 1:
A kind of intelligent home control system, as shown in Figure 1, including control host, being installed on indoor different zones for supervising
Survey environmental information sensor group, for receives control host remote control commands and execute action equipment control group, with
And mobile terminal;Wherein sensor group, equipment control group and mobile terminal are connect with control host;In the present embodiment, pass
Sensor group includes CO concentration detection sensors, smokescope detection sensor, infrared thermal imaging sensor, siphon pressure sensor
And water pipe flow detection sensor.Equipment control group includes motorized window, gas valve, Intelligent sprayer and penstock, intelligence
Nozzle is rotatable to be fixed on room area.It should be noted that infrared thermal imaging sensor and Intelligent sprayer are rotatable
Be fixed on room area.For the ease of spraying the accurate alignment target conflagration area of Intelligent sprayer, infrared thermal imaging passes
The rotation angle of sensor and Intelligent sprayer is consistent, i.e. infrared thermal imaging sensor and Intelligent sprayer synchronous rotary.
As shown in Fig. 2, control host includes:Information acquisition module, data processing module and communication module.
Information acquisition module obtains the environmental information of sensor group acquisition, and the environmental information includes gas concentration, smog
Concentration, indoor temperature, siphon pressure and water pipe flow.In the present embodiment, information acquisition module obtains CO Concentration Testings respectively
Sensor, smokescope detection sensor, infrared thermal imaging sensor, siphon pressure sensor and water pipe flow detection sensing
The information of device acquisition.Wherein, infrared thermal imaging sensor judges Indoor Temperature by acquiring the infrared profile information of room area
The height of degree.For the ease of whether there is water leakage situation in judgement water pipe, there are two the settings of siphon pressure sensor, two water pipes
Pressure sensor is respectively arranged in the front end of water pipe branch and the rear end of water pipe branch, that is, the siphon pressure measured includes two
Group, two groups of siphon pressures are respectively from the loine pressure of water pipe branch front end and rear end.Water pipe flow detection sensor is examined
The water pipe flow of survey is the water flow in water pipe branch.
Data processing module:Receive information acquisition module obtain environmental information, and to the environmental information of acquisition at
Reason.Specifically, data processing module includes:The pre- judging unit of gas concentration comparison unit, fire, fire location judging unit,
Water pipe flow judging unit and pipe leakage judging unit.
Gas concentration comparison unit:The gas concentration of information acquisition module acquisition is obtained, and by the gas concentration and in advance
The gas concentration threshold values of setting is compared, if gas concentration exceeds presetting gas concentration threshold values, generates equipment control
Group opens and closes instruction and alarm command, and it includes gas valve out code that the equipment control group, which opens and closes instruction,.In the present embodiment,
Gas concentration comparison unit obtains the CO gas concentrations of information acquisition module acquisition, and by CO gas concentrations and presetting gas
Concentration threshold values is compared, in the present embodiment, presetting 1 milligram/cubic metre of CO gas concentrations threshold values.If CO gas concentrations are super
Go out 1 milligram/cubic metre, then generates gas valve out code and gas leakage warning instruction simultaneously.Gas valve closing refers to
It enables and gas leakage warning instruction is respectively sent to gas valve and mobile terminal by communication module.Gas valve receives
Valve is closed after gas valve out code.Mobile terminal knows the exceeded warning messages of indoor CO.In order to which harm is quickly discharged
Evil, it further includes motorized window open command that preferred equipment control group, which opens and closes instruction, and motorized window open command is sent by communication module
To motorized window, motorized window is opened after receiving motorized window open command.
The pre- judging unit of fire:The smokescope of information acquisition module acquisition is obtained, and by the smokescope and is preset
Fixed smokescope threshold values is compared, if smokescope concentration exceeds presetting smokescope threshold values, generates equipment control
Processed group opens and closes instruction and alarm command, and it includes that fire occurs to confirm instruction that the equipment control group, which opens and closes instruction,.Smokescope
Threshold values can be set according to the indoor standard smokescope value of safety precaution defined.
Fire location judging unit:The fire received in the pre- judging unit of fire confirms instruction, obtains information acquisition module
If the indoor temperature of acquisition generates equipment control group and opens detect that indoor a certain regional temperature is higher than other indoor temperatures
Instruction is closed, it includes that fire location confirms instruction that the equipment control group, which opens and closes instruction,.In the present embodiment, fire location judging unit
After receiving the fire confirmation instruction in the pre- judging unit of fire, the indoor infrared heat distribution of infrared thermal imaging sensor acquisition is obtained
Image information judges whether indoor some region of temperature is apparently higher than other indoor temperatures, really according to infrared thermal map picture
Behind the fixed region, then generates fire location and confirms that instruction, fire location confirm that instruction is sent to Intelligent sprayer by communication module,
Intelligent sprayer confirms that instruction rotation is sprayed to target area, and to target area according to fire location.
In order to record fire area, resident is facilitated to carry out the investigation of fire incident, equipment control group further includes camera, is taken the photograph
It is fixed on room area as rotatable.For the ease of the shooting to target area, camera and infrared thermal imaging sensor
And the equal synchronous rotary of Intelligent sprayer.Control host further includes information storage module, and camera is connect with control host.Work as camera shooting
Head receives after fire location confirms instruction, and camera shoots target area, and by the photo or video information of shooting
Information storage module is stored, and information storage module is connect with data processing module, and storage can be believed by communication module
Breath is transmitted to mobile terminal.
Water pipe flow judging unit:When the water pipe flow of acquisition information acquisition module acquisition is constant, sends pipe leakage and sentence
Severed finger enables.In the present embodiment, the flow in water pipe branch is detected by water pipe flow detection sensor, if judging in water pipe branch
Flow it is constant when, then showing indoor water pipe branch, nobody uses water.Flow pipe is issued with water state leak decision instruction at nobody.
Pipe leakage judging unit:Pipe leakage decision instruction is received, while obtaining the water pipe of information acquisition module acquisition
Pressure, if judging to calculate siphon pressure difference and carrying out the siphon pressure difference and presetting siphon pressure difference pair
Than if siphon pressure difference exceeds presetting siphon pressure difference, generating equipment control group keying instruction and alarm referring to
It enables, it includes water valve out code that the equipment control group, which opens and closes instruction,.In the present embodiment, the siphon pressure of water pipe branch front end passes
The pressure difference value that sensor and the siphon pressure sensor of water pipe branch rear end are detected exceeds presetting siphon pressure difference, example
Such as, preheating setting pressure difference is 0Mpa, i.e., in the case of unmanned with water, if there is no leakage, water pipe branch for water pipe branch
The pressure difference of road front and back end is 0Mpa.If the pressure difference value of detection is more than 0Mpa, the case where showing water pipe branch there are leaks,
The water pipe branch needs repairing.Pipe leakage judging unit generates water valve out code and alarm command.Water valve out code
And alarm command is respectively sent to penstock and mobile terminal by communication module, after penstock receives water valve out code
It is automatically closed.
